OLD TOWN and STILLWATER Julie L. Hicks, 38, passed away unexpectedly Sunday, Aug. 1, 2004, at a Bangor hospital. She was born Nov. 15, 1965, in Bangor, the daughter of Alan P. and Betty A. (Currier) Thurston. Julie was a devoted loving mother to her three daughters and enjoyed spending time with them. She enjoyed shopping, cooking and was a cheering coach for eight years for the Police Athletic League. In addition to her parents, she is survived by her loving husband of 12 years, Tony Hicks of Old Town; three daughters, Nicole, Ashly and Chantal; sister, Lori Osnoe and her husband, Tim, and their daughter, Morgan of Glenburn; several aunts and uncles. A memorial mass will be celebrated 10 a.m. Friday at Holy Family Parish in Old Town, with the Rev. Normand Richard celebrant. Committal will be held at Lawndale Cemetery immediately following the mass. Friends and family are invited to the Holy Family Parish Hall for a luncheon and continued fellowship following the burial. In lieu of flowers, those who wish may send contributions to Eastern Maine Charities “In Memory of Julie Hicks” P.O. Box 404, Bangor, ME 04402-0404. Arrangements in the care of Birmingham Funeral Home, 438 Main St., Old Town. www.dignitymemorial.com
